Detailsinfo

A vulnerability, which was classified as critical, has been found in Linux Kernel up to 6.17.9. Affected by this issue is the function tcm_loop_tpg_address_show of the component scsi. The manipulation with an unknown input leads to a null pointer dereference vulnerability. Using CWE to declare the problem leads to CWE-476. A NULL pointer dereference occurs when the application dereferences a pointer that it expects to be valid, but is NULL, typically causing a crash or exit. Impacted is availability. CVE summarizes:

In the Linux kernel, the following vulnerability has been resolved: scsi: target: tcm_loop: Fix segfault in tcm_loop_tpg_address_show() If the allocation of tl_hba->sh fails in tcm_loop_driver_probe() and we attempt to dereference it in tcm_loop_tpg_address_show() we will get a segfault, see below for an example. So, check tl_hba->sh before dereferencing it. Unable to allocate struct scsi_host BUG: kernel NULL pointer dereference, address: 0000000000000194 #PF: supervisor read access in kernel mode #PF: error_code(0x0000) - not-present page PGD 0 P4D 0 Oops: 0000 [#1] PREEMPT SMP NOPTI CPU: 1 PID: 8356 Comm: tokio-runtime-w Not tainted 6.6.104.2-4.azl3 #1 Hardware name: Microsoft Corporation Virtual Machine/Virtual Machine, BIOS Hyper-V UEFI Release v4.1 09/28/2024 RIP: 0010:tcm_loop_tpg_address_show+0x2e/0x50 [tcm_loop] ... Call Trace: <TASK> configfs_read_iter+0x12d/0x1d0 [configfs] vfs_read+0x1b5/0x300 ksys_read+0x6f/0xf0 ...

The advisory is shared for download at git.kernel.org. This vulnerability is handled as CVE-2025-68229 since 12/16/2025. The exploitation is known to be difficult. There are known technical details, but no exploit is available.

The vulnerability scanner Nessus provides a plugin with the ID 282382 (Amazon Linux 2023 : bpftool, kernel, kernel-devel (ALAS2023-2025-1350)), which helps to determine the existence of the flaw in a target environment.

Upgrading to version 5.4.302, 5.10.247, 5.15.197, 6.1.159, 6.6.118, 6.12.60 or 6.17.10 eliminates this vulnerability. Applying the patch 63f511d3855f7f4b35dd63dbc58fc3d935a81268/3d8c517f6eb27e47b1a198e05f8023038329b40b/f449a1edd7a13bb025aaf9342ea6f8bf92684bbf/1c9ba455b5073253ceaadae4859546e38e8261fe/a6ef60898ddaf1414592ce3e5b0d94276d631663/72e8831079266749a7023618a0de2f289a9dced6/13aff3b8a7184281b134698704d6c06863a8361b/e6965188f84a7883e6a0d3448e86b0cf29b24dfc is able to eliminate this problem. The bugfix is ready for download at git.kernel.org. The best possible mitigation is suggested to be upgrading to the latest version.
